The storm passed. Trees are still standing. Everything looks fine.

That's usually when people stop paying attention.

The problem is, storm damage isn't always obvious. Heavy wind can crack branches, weaken connections, and split limbs in ways you won't see from the driveway. Then the next gust comes through and finishes the job – usually onto something you didn't want it to land on.

So after a big storm, walk the property and look for these warning signs:

Hanging limbs
Cracked branches
Split trunks
Leaning trees
Branches near power lines

If anything looks off, don't wait it out. Storm damage gets worse fast – especially with more wind or weight. What seems minor today can turn into a serious safety risk by next week.

Spring's here. Before you fire up the mower or start setting up the patio, take ten minutes and look up.

Niagara winters are hard on trees. Heavy ice and wind puts stress on branches, weakens structure, and leaves behind damage that doesn't always show itself right away – until a bad spring storm finds it for you.

Here's what to look for:

Broken or hanging branches that could fall
Discolouration or decay (signs of disease)
Deadwood buildup that weakens the tree
Cracks or splits in larger limbs

A quick check now is the difference between a small fix and a major problem. Small issues are cheaper, easier, and a lot less stressful to deal with before they become safety hazards.

Pruning isn't just about making a tree look tidy.

Done right, it improves tree health, strengthens structure, encourages safer growth, and prevents future issues before they come about.

Done wrong, it weakens the tree, leads to poor growth, increases safety risks, and can cause long-term damage that takes years to show up – and even longer to fix.

The difference comes down to timing and technique. Different trees need different approaches, and pruning at the wrong time of year can do more harm than leaving it alone.

Most people think tree removal is just "cut it down and haul it away."

It's not.

Every removal starts with an assessment – size, lean, damage, and what's around it. Homes, fences, power lines. One wrong move and a routine job becomes an expensive one.

That's why trees come down piece by piece. Each cut is controlled. Each section is lowered with ropes and rigging – not dropped.

It's slower. It's more work. But it's the only way to take down a tree without taking something else with it.
